In order to investigate influence of fabric of kaolin clay on secondary consolidation behavior, samples were prepared which have different fabrics, that is, samples with the addition of quanties of aluminum sulfate about 0-10%. The consolidation test were caried out for these samples under various conditions. Some of the obtained results are as follows: (1) The coefficient of secondary consolidation
Cα increases with increasing the average size of peds
P50. This seems to suggest that the volume decrease of clay due to the compression of micro-pores in the secondary stage were predominated, owing to the number of micro-pores increases with increasing
P50. (2) The elapsed time
ts at which
e-log
t curves give straight lines is affected by Δ
p/
p and
P50. Namely,
ts increases with increasing
P50, and these trends are predominated when Δ
p/
p is decreased, but,
ts is not affected by Δ
p/
p and
P50 when the preconsolidation pressure is increased.
